11 - Appointment of authority.

§ 11. Appointment of authority. The members of the authority shall be appointed by the governor by and with the advice and consent of the senate. Not more than two members of the authority shall belong to the same political party. The chairman of the state alcoholic beverage control board heretofore appointed and designated by the governor and the remaining members of such board heretofore appointed by the governor shall continue to serve as chairman and members of the authority until the expiration of the respective terms for which they were appointed. Upon the expiration of such respective terms the successors of such chairman and members shall be appointed to serve for a term of three years each and until their successors have been appointed and qualified.
